Who introduced the first ATM?

John Shepherd-Barron
The first ATM was set up in June 1967 on a street in Enfield, London at a branch of Barclays bank. A British inventor named John Shepherd-Barron is credited with its invention. The machine allowed customers to withdraw a maximum of GBP10 at a time.

When was the first ATM introduced?

September 1969
In the U.S., Dallas-based engineer Donald Wetzel pioneered the development and deployment of the ATM, with the first being installed at the Chemical Bank branch in Rockville Center, New York, in September 1969. And ATM popularity continued to grow around the world.

Which is Indian Bank introduced the first ATM in India?

HSBC — the Hongkong and Shanghai Banking Corporation — was the first bank to introduce the ATM concept in India way back in 1987. Now, most of the banks have their ATM outlets in India. When was the first ATM set up in the world? When did India get one? The first use of ATM magstripe cards is said to have been made in 1969 when Docutel installed its Docuteller machine at New York’s Chemical Bank. This is the first recorded use of magnetically encoded plastic. Donald C Wetzel is given credit for developing the machine for Docutel.

Which is the best ATM sharing network in India?

After the collapse of Swadhan, Bank of India, Union Bank of India, Indian Bank, United Bank of India and Syndicate Bank formed an ATM-sharing network called CashTree. Citibank, the Industrial Development Bank of India, Standard Chartered Bank and Axis Bank formed a similar network called Cashnet.
